Heating Unit Maintenance

Regular maintenance prevents lots of he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C professionals carry out thorough upkeep services that consist of: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for fractures
  • Checking combustion effectiveness
  • Testing safety controls
  • Cleaning up or changing filters
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Cleaning up bur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work harder and decreases comfort. Our HVAC professionals determine airflow issues, whether triggered by duct issues,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an improperly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can identify these issues and suggest sol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ears out parts fa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the issue comes from a clogged fil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t increases in energy bills frequently show H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ists carry out energy performance assessments to determine the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ems should ass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can suggest options to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what appears like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can repair or replace th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or clever designs for much better convenience control and energy cost savings.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ency HVAC Services

What qualifies as an HVAC emergency?
An HVAC emergency is any circumstance that:
  • Entirely disables your heating or cooling system during extreme weather condition
  • Develops safety dangers (like gas leaks or electrical issues)
  • Threatens to damage your home (such as water leakages)
  • Makes your home uninhabitable due to severe temperatures
